A method is provided for processing multiple types of pixel component representations. The method first includes identifying a plurality of texels in a texture pattern grid that correspond to a pixel. Thereafter, information components of the pixel, i.e. R, G, B, and .alpha. are multiplied if the information components of the pixel are in a postmultiplied representation. Further, a colorkeyed replacement operation is carried out if the information components of the pixel are in a colorkeyed representation and at least one of the texels substantially matches a colorkey. Next, a position is interpolated on the texture pattern grid between the texels that corresponds to the pixel. Finally, the information components of the pixel are filtered.
